Are you feeling an itch in your ear after wearing your hearing aids? You're not alone! Many people ears are clogged from congestion face this common issue. The itching can be caused by a few various factors, such as sweat buildup, friction from the device, or even an allergic reaction to certain materials.

First, it's essential to ensure that your hearing aids are properly and aren't too loose on your ear canal. This can often be the root cause of itching. If you notice any discomfort or irritation, don't hesitate to consult with an audiologist to adjust your hearing aids for a more pleasant fit.
- Regularly clean your hearing aid domes following the manufacturer's instructions. This will help remove any earwax that could be irritating your skin.
- Choose hypoallergenic materials for your hearing aid domes. These are less likely to cause allergic reactions or irritation.
- If you experience persistent itching, consider using a over-the-counter ear cream or lotion recommended by your doctor.
